The standard components of any kind of pressure washing machine, from a commercial size to a home version, are a water intake hose, an engine, a water pump, a cleansing area, and the nozzle or result pipe. The equipment absorbs water after that pumps it out with any type of cleansing option at a high price of speed, where the water is pressurized into a tiny but powerful stream.

Building supervisors can call expert power washing machines to get rid of everything from efflorescence to dried out bird droppings. Pressure washing machines can be utilized with multiple nozzle alternatives that make cleaning nearly any kind of tarnish from any type of surface feasible and safe, Popular Mechanics kept in mind. There are nozzles with different angles to assist get rid of specific stains in addition to adjustments to limit or loosen water pressure.

Pressure cleaning is often made use of to clean buildings, smooth surfaces and devices on campus. Pressure cleaning can adversely affect water quality if not done properly. Usage completely dry techniques such as mops, blowers or street sweepers to clean up the location before utilizing a stress washer on any type of surface area. Block off tornado drains pipes first to avoid particles from going into.
EHS has actually commonly discovered that using chemicals does not boost the result. Price financial savings can be considerable without the use of chemicals, given that the wastewater typically does not require to be captured and transferred to a disposal center (Roof Moss Removal). If a chemical cleaner must be utilized for stress washing, take the adhering to steps: Get in touch with EHS to official website obtain a map of the tornado drains around the project site
This can involve tarps, berms, storm drainpipe covers or mats, pipe plugs, pumps, and so on. The various other alternative is to collect the wastewater in a drum or container and get rid of offsite for disposal at an accredited wastewater center.
Try using scrub brushes first, and if chemicals are still required, wipe-on-wipe-off products serve. If a huge area calls for chemical treatment, see the demands in the "Utilizing Chemical Cleansers" section above. Stress cleaning in some locations require extra precautions to guarantee that the materials being washed do not go into the storm drain system.

Drainage from those areas should be recorded and not permitted to discharge into storm drains pipes. Grease and food waste that spills or splashes onto the ground must be cleansed utilizing dry approaches such as absorbent products or shop vacs. If degreaser will certainly be needed, get in touch with EHS for assist with a clean-up strategy that will consist of obstructing the storm drains and accumulating wastewater.

If the filling dock is otherwise without fluid contamination, adhere to the stress washing actions detailed over. Debris tracked off construction sites of any type of dimension need to not be cleaned right into tornado drains pipes. Debris needs to be cleansed making use of just completely dry approaches (road sweeper, mops, shovels, and so on).

Pressure washing is a very efficient approach for cleaning up a selection of surfaces, ranging from home outsides and driveways to decks and vehicles. By making use of an effective stream of water, pressure washing can get rid of dust, grime, mold, and various other impurities that regular cleansing methods may miss out on. Appropriate method and tools selection are important to avoid damaging the surfaces being cleansed.
To start, get rid of the area of any type of obstacles such as furnishings, plants, or debris. Safeguard neighboring plants and electrical outlets by covering them with plastic sheeting or decline cloths. Evaluate the surface area for any type of loose paint, fractures, or damage that need repair work. Usage waterproof caulk to seal any splits and allow it to completely dry entirely.
